Game Producer, Kids

Remote Full-time
Netflix is one of the world's leading entertainment services, with over 300 million paid memberships in over 190 countries enjoying TV series, films and games across a wide variety of genres and languages. Members can play, pause and resume watching as much as they want, anytime, anywhere, and can change their plans at any time. Netflix is looking for a versatile and engaged Producer to join our dynamic Games Production team and contribute to our goal of bringing best-in-class Kids games to our members. We're a team with big ambitions and an obsession to deliver memorable game moments that leave players telling their own stories for years to come. As a part of Netflix, we strive to hire the best and value integrity, excellence, respect, inclusion, and collaboration. As a Netflix Games Producer for Kids games, you will be at the forefront of managing and delivering high-quality games. Working with the Executive and Lead Producers, you will be instrumental in guiding game development teams to ensure projects are executed within scope, time and budget to surprise and delight our members’ kids and families. This role is remote with PST time zone preferred. We hold quarterly in-person onsites at our Los Angeles or Los Gatos offices. Responsibilities: β€’ Define and oversee milestone deliverables and project production, identifying and assessing project risks to provide expert recommendations and ensure predictable delivery timelines. β€’ Provide constructive feedback to game teams to enhance overall game quality while upholding the high standards across gameplay, visuals, branding, and design. β€’ Foster effective collaboration and problem-solving with development teams to drive successful game development. β€’ Partner with cross-functional teams to conduct thorough developer due diligence and reviews. β€’ Plan and manage Live Services transition points, working closely with the Live Services team for a smooth handover to enable high quality continued support of live titles. β€’ Utilize data-driven insights to inform decisions and improve key performance indicators towards the business goals. Requirements: β€’ Minimum 5 years of experience in games production, with an emphasis on mobile games. β€’ In-depth experience of games project planning and management. β€’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to build strong relationships. β€’ Strong problem-solving skills and a keen eye for detail. β€’ Ability to manage and deliver multiple projects simultaneously. β€’ Passion for collaboration, continuous learning, and professional development. β€’ Commitment to fostering an inclusive and diverse work environment. β€’ Adaptability to change and maintaining composure in fast-paced, ambiguous environments. β€’ Ability to provide expert guidance with quick turnaround times. β€’ Self-motivated and comfortable working autonomously. β€’ Experience in a game publishing environment (nice to have) Generally, our compensation structure consists solely of an annual salary; we do not have bonuses. You choose each year how much of your compensation you want in salary versus stock options. To determine your personal top of market compensation, we rely on market indicators and consider your specific job family, background, skills, and experience to determine your compensation in the market range. The range for this role is $60,000 - $270,000. Netflix provides comprehensive benefits including Health Plans, Mental Health support, a 401(k) Retirement Plan with employer match, Stock Option Program, Disability Programs, Health Savings and Flexible Spending Accounts, Family-forming benefits, and Life and Serious Injury Benefits. We also offer paid leave of absence programs. Full-time hourly employees accrue 35 days annually for paid time off to be used for vacation, holidays, and sick paid time off. Full-time salaried employees are immediately entitled to flexible time off. See more detail about our Benefits here.
